Black Geometric Jacket with Panier Hips - $500
This jacket is made from a black geometric quilted fabric and is trimmed with black cording. The panier hips are created using a series of darts placed strategically to form the sculptural hip shape. The coat is fully lined in gold silk dupioni. $500 -

Silver Lame Jacket with Panier Hips - $300
This jacket is constructed with eight darts, two in the bodice, one on each shoulder, and two on each hip. This is how the panier hip is created. The jacket is finished with a frog closure and is lined with heavy black lining. $300
